Product Spotlight: TPMS Tools

The Tire Industry Association estimates that there are more than 50 million vehicles equipped with TPMS already on America’s roadways, making TPMS service one of the fastest-growing business opportunities for tire dealers. Multi-Application TPMS Sensor Simplifies Service

Earlier this week, Continental Corp.’s Commercial Vehicles & Aftermarket division introduced its new TPMS solution, which the company said works with all existing scan tools, saving significant time and money for parts and service professionals.
